We describe a possibility to explain the $2.6\sigma$ deviation from lepton flavour universality observed by the LHCb collaboration in $B^+\to K^+\ell^+\ell^-$ decays in the context of minimal composite Higgs models. We find that a sizable degree of compositeness of partially composite muons can lead to a good agreement with the experimental data. Our construction predicts a new physics contribution to $B_s$-$\bar{B}_s$ mixing. Additionally, it accounts for the deficit in the invisible $Z$ width measured at LEP.
